Specifications

  • Input Voltage Range: 2.3V to 6.0V
  • Output Voltage Range: 0.8V to 5.5V
  • Maximum Output Current: 1A
  • Dropout Voltage: 210mV at 1A
  • Quiescent Current: 120µA
  • Operating Temperature Range: -40°C to +125°C

Working Principles

The MCP1827T-ADJE/ET operates by taking an input voltage and regulating it to a desired output voltage. It achieves this through the use of internal circuitry that adjusts the voltage based on the feedback received from the adjustment pin.
